Tour Overview

Embark on the "Garden Route Splendor" tour and experience the breathtaking beauty of South Africa. Begin your journey in Johannesburg, exploring its rich history and vibrant culture. Travel through the lush Tsitsikamma National Park, marvel at the dramatic coastline, and visit the serene Knysna Lagoon. Discover the fascinating world of ostrich farming in Oudtshoorn and the awe-inspiring Cango Caves. Witness the majestic whales off Hermanus' coast and enjoy the picturesque landscapes of the Cape Winelands. Conclude your adventure in the iconic city of Cape Town, soaking in its natural beauty and legendary attractions. Enjoy comfortable accommodations, delicious meals, and expert guidance throughout this unforgettable journey.

Day 1: Johannesburg Arrival

Location: Johannesburg

Accommodation Name: hotel

Welcome to South Africa! Upon arrival at Johannesburg Airport, you will be met by a representative and transferred to your hotel for check-in. Spend the rest of the day at leisure or perhaps join the following city tour:




Overnight in Johannesburg

Day 2: Johannesburg - Port Elizabeth – Tsitsikamma (B/-/-)

Location: Tsitsikamma

Accommodation Name: hotel

Meals Included: Breakfast

After breakfast at the hotel, ride the shuttle back to the airport where you will board your flight to Port Elizabeth. Upon arrival at Port Elizabeth Airport, you will be met by a representative and transferred to your hotel for check-in.In the afternoon, head westwards to explore the magnificent beauty of the indigenous Tsitsikamma Forest. Visit the spectacularly beautiful Tsitsikamma National Park and Storms River Mouth (weather permitting). Upon arrival, the rest of the afternoon is at leisure to relax or explore the town on your own.




Overnight in Tsitsikamma

Day 3: Tsitsikamma--Knysna (B/-/D)

Location: Knysna

Accommodation Name: hotel

Meals Included: Breakfast, Dinner

Start your day with a hearty breakfast before heading to the stunning Tsitsikamma National Park and Storms River Mouth, where you can explore the dramatic rocky coastline, remote mountains, and lush temperate forests, weather permitting. Afterward, journey along the scenic Garden Route to Knysna, known as the oyster capital of South Africa, nestled on the banks of a beautiful lagoon. Upon arrival, relax before enjoying a sunset cruise to the Knysna Heads, taking in the breathtaking views. Conclude your day with a delightful dinner at Drydock Restaurant, renowned for its dishes made with the finest local ingredients and freshly picked herbs.




Overnight in Knysna

Day 4: Knysna – Oudtshoorn (B/L/-)

Location: Oudtshoorn

Accommodation Name: hotel

Meals Included: Breakfast, Lunch

Travel through the picturesque Outeniqua Pass to Oudtshoorn, the \"ostrich capital\" and the center of the worlds ostrich farming industry. On the way, visit 'Dolphin Point' in Wilderness for stunning views. In Oudtshoorn, take an interactive tour of an Ostrich Farm, followed by a light lunch featuring local specialties like Ostrich Steak. Next, explore the magnificent limestone caverns of the Cango Caves, one of the world's natural wonders. Arrive at your hotel in the late afternoon to check in and relax before dinner.




Overnight in Oudtshoorn

Day 5: Oudtshoorn – Hermanus (B/-/-)

Location: Hermanus

Accommodation Name: hotel

Meals Included: Breakfast

After breakfast, the journey continues through the ‘Little Karoo to Barrydale, where you will have the opportunity to visit a local farm school, interact with the children and teachers, spending time with them in the classroom learning more about the local farming community, before travelling to Montagu, a picturesque and historic spa town. (The school visit is subject to the school being open). Continue to Franschhoek, a picturesque village surrounded by spectacular vineyards, where French Huguenots settled more than 300 years ago, bringing with them their age-old French wine and food culture. 




Overnight in Hermanus

Day 6: Hermanus --Capetown - (B/-/-)

Location: Cape Town

Meals Included: Breakfast

After a leisurely breakfast, leave Hermanus and travel to Somerset West via the breathtaking coastal road. Continue to Stellenbosch in the beautiful Cape Winelands, where you'll have free time to explore the towns oak-shaded streets, charming cafés, boutiques, and art galleries. Finally, head to Cape Town, where the tour concludes upon arrival. This afternoon you will be transferred back to Cape Town International Airport for your overnight flight home.
